Dinokeng Game Reserve
Located just over an hour’s drive from Johannesburg and Pretoria, Dinokeng Game Reserve is a remarkable wildlife destination known for being Gauteng’s only Big Five reserve in a free-roaming environment. Covering more than 19,000 hectares, it offers a real African safari experience within easy reach of the city—making it ideal for day visitors, weekend getaways, and nature lovers seeking adventure without long-distance travel.
Pretoria City Tour
Discover the rich tapestry of South African history, culture, and architecture on a Pretoria City Tour — a scenic and insightful journey through the nation’s administrative capital. Known as the "Jacaranda City" for its thousands of blossoming purple trees in spring, Pretoria blends historic grandeur with modern vibrancy, offering visitors a unique window into South Africa’s past and present.

Glen Afric Elephant Experience
Located near Hartbeespoort, at the base of the Magaliesberg and within the Cradle of Humankind Biosphere, Glen Afric offers a rare and ethical opportunity to connect with a small, semi-habituated herd of elephants—Three, Marty, and Hannah—on guided walks or feeding experiences

Ukutula Lion Walk
Just under two hours from Pretoria and Johannesburg, the Ukutula Lion Walk offers a thrilling yet responsible wildlife encounter in a 260-hectare conservation-focused game reserve . As part of the Guided Enrichment Walk, you'll stroll through natural bushveld alongside young lions, observing their behavior in a more open setting — no touching, no riding — just respectful immersion
